How Our Office Building Water Damage Restoration Process Works
When water damage strikes your office building, every minute counts. That’s why our team follows a meticulous process to ensure a swift and effective restoration. From initial assessment to final cleanup, we’ll guide you through every step of the way.
Step 1: Emergency Response
Within 60 minutes of your call, our team will arrive on-site to ass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your office building.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your office building. Our team will also use specialized equipment to dry the affected are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. We’ll also use specialized equipment to dry your office building’s contents, including furniture and equipment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the water has been removed and the area is dry, our team will thoroughly clean and sanitize the affected areas. This includes disinfecting surfaces, removing any remaining moisture, and restoring your office building to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Report
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your office building is safe and secure. We’ll provide a comprehensive report detailing the work completed and any recommendations for future maintenance.

Warning Signs You Need Office Building Water Damage Restoration
Water damage can be sneaky, but there are warning signs to look out for.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ice a musty smell in your office building, it’s time to investigate further.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ice stains on your ceiling or walls, don’t ignore them, they could be a sign of a bigger issue.
Buckled or Warped Flooring
Buckled or warped fl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ice this in your office building, it’s time to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Unusual Noises or Sounds
Unusual noises or sounds can be a sign of water damage. If you notice strange noises coming from your office building’s walls or ceiling, it’s time to investigate further.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ks can be a sign of a bigger issue. If you notice water leaking from your office building’s pipes, fixtures, or appliances, don’t ignore it, call us immediately.
High Humidity or Moisture
High humidity or moisture can be a sign of water damage. If you notice high humidity or moisture in your office building, it’s time to take action to prevent further damage.

Office Building Water Damage Restoration Cost in Hurst, TX
The cost of Office Building Water Damage Restoration in Hurst,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on industry standards and may not reflect the actual cost of the work.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Report |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of the work |
| Emergency Response | $100 – $500 | Time of day, distance to the job site |
| Insurance Claims Help | $0 – $1,000 | Complexity of the claims process, type of insurance coverage |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and a free estimate is available upon request.
